Agile Project Management in Large Organizations: Challenges and Solutions

Abstract: Agile project management has achieved significant appeal due to its adaptability, iterative methodology, and capacity to provide rapid value delivery. However, its implementation in large organizations presents unique challenges that can hinder its effectiveness. This article examines the principal hurdles encountered by large enterprises in implementing Agile techniques and suggests pragmatic strategies to address these issues. Key issues include cultural resistance, organizational inertia, and the complexity of coordinating multiple teams and large-scale projects. The paper examines strategies for fostering an Agile-friendly culture, such as leadership support, comprehensive training programs, and the promotion of Agile values across all organizational levels. Furthermore, it examines the application of frameworks such as the Scaled Agile Framework (SAFe) and Agile Release Trains to improve collaboration and communication throughout extensive teams. The document emphasizes the advantages and difficulties of hybrid methodologies that integrate Agile with conventional project management techniques. The article offers insights into best practices and lessons learned from case studies of big firms that have effectively embraced Agile. Finally, it covers key performance indicators (KPIs) for measuring the effectiveness of Agile projects and discusses emerging trends that may determine the future of Agile project management in large businesses. This paper attempts to offer a thorough guide for large organizations looking to take advantage of Agile approaches while navigating the hurdles of large-scale project management by addressing these issues and providing workable answers.
